Claims
- 1. An acoustic vibrational material comprising a fiber reinforcement material and a elastomer modified epoxy resin, said elastomer modified epoxy resin comprising
- an epoxy resin; and
- a polybutadiene elastomer wherein the elastomer has principal chain terminals, the terminals having functional groups selected from the group consisting of hydroxyl, carboxyl, thiol, acid anhydride, primary amine, secondary amine and tertiary amine and containing not less than 90 mole percent of 1,2-linked units, the polybutadiene elastomer being incorporated into the molecular chains of the epoxy resin;
- wherein the mole ratio of the polybutadiene elastomer to the epoxy resin is between 1:9 and 1:3.
- 2. An acoustic vibrational material of claim 1 wherein the elastomer is blended with the epoxy resin allowing a part or all of the elastomer to react during curing.
- 3. An acoustic vibrational material of claim 1 wherein the fiber reinforcement material is selected from the group consisting of aramid fiber, glass fiber, carbon fiber, ultra-drawn polyethylene fiber and polyallylates.
- 4. The acoustic vibrational material of claim 1 wherein the elastomer is incorporated into the molecular chains of the epoxy resin by reacting the elastomer with the epoxy resin prior to curing the epoxy resin.
- 5. An acoustic vibrational material comprising:
- fiber reinforcement material; and
- an elastomer modified epoxy resin bound to said fiber reinforcement material, said resin formed by reacting a tri-functional glycidyl amine epoxy monomer with a polybutadiene elastomer containing 95 mole percent 1,2 linked units and having carboxyl principal chain terminal groups, wherein said elastomer is present in a range of 10 to 25 mole percent based on said epoxy monomer.
